Leadership Review Briefing — Entry into the Soverin Coast

Prepared for sales leads. Our phased entry into the Soverin Coast region begins with two anchor accounts secured through Marwick & Dale. Initial headcount is six field sellers, supported by the Ardenfell fulfilment hub. Demand modelling suggests break-even within fourteen months, assuming moderate competitive response. Pipeline targets will be issued separately. Strategic context is provided in the confidential note immediately below.

internal memo for hahif-hahaf: Headcount on the Zorwyn team goes from 9 to 100 by the end of October. Gross margin on Zorwyn came in at 5 percent against a plan of 10 percent.

# Splitline Environments

Splitline, our A/B experiment assignment service, runs in three environments: dev, staging, and prod. Assignment hashing is identical across all three; only traffic sources and bucket persistence differ. Staging mirrors prod topology at one-tenth scale. Each environment reads one config bundle at boot. The current prod bundle values are shown below.

deployment values, hahip-kajep:
HOLAX_PIN=4003
HOLAX_METRICS_HOST=metrics.holax.zemvarworks.internal
HOLAX_LOG_LEVEL=warn
HOLAX_TENANT=fraael

Runbook: Scanline barcode bridge

If warehouse scans stop flowing into Cartwheel, it's almost always the bridge service on the Dunmore floor box wedging after a USB hiccup. Bounce the service first — nine times out of ten that fixes it. If not, check the queue depth before escalating. When restarting, make sure the bridge comes up with these settings.

deployment values, yafop-bajef:
[gilok]
team = ulaius
access_code = ac_423664
host = gilok.sivrelhq.corp
port = 9200
owner = pelius.istax
peer = eliok.torvasoft.internal

## Calendar sync conflict — triage

When the Moorfield scheduling bridge detects divergent event versions between Hallon Calendar and the internal roster, it quarantines the event rather than overwriting either side. Verify the quarantine queue is draining and confirm that conflict resolution never bypasses the audit log, as silent merges were the root cause of the prior incident. The bridge runs with the following configuration.

settings of tagef-bawif:
DRUIX_HOST=druix.zemvarlabs.internal
DRUIX_PORT=8000